Plattform
linux
Komponente
musl
Behoben in
1.2.1
1.2.2
1.2.3
1.2.4
1.2.5
1.2.6
1.2.7
CVE-2026-6042 details an inefficiency in musl libc versions 1.2.0 through 1.2.6. The vulnerability resides within the GB18030 4-byte Decoder, resulting in inefficient algorithmic complexity. This issue is localized and primarily impacts performance rather than security. A patch is recommended to mitigate this vulnerability.
Eine Schwachstelle wurde in musl libc bis Version 1.2.6 entdeckt, insbesondere in der Funktion 'iconv' innerhalb der Komponente GB18030 4-Byte Decoder (befindlich in src/locale/iconv.c). Diese Schwachstelle äußert sich als ineffiziente algorithmische Komplexität. Obwohl sie keine Remote-Codeausführung ermöglicht, kann ein lokaler Angreifer diese Schwäche ausnutzen, um Systemressourcen erheblich zu verbrauchen, was potenziell zu einer Denial-of-Service (DoS)-Situation führen kann. Die Schwere der Schwachstelle hängt von der Umgebung und der Arbeitslast des betroffenen Systems ab. Das Fehlen einer sofortigen Behebung (fix: none) bedeutet, dass Benutzer Patches proaktiv anwenden müssen, um das Risiko zu mindern. Das Fehlen eines KEV-Eintrags (Kernel Exploit Vulnerability) deutet darauf hin, dass bis zum heutigen Zeitpunkt keine öffentlichen oder weit verbreiteten Exploits gemeldet wurden.
Die Schwachstelle erfordert lokalen Zugriff auf das betroffene System. Dies bedeutet, dass ein Angreifer die Berechtigung haben muss, Code auf dem System auszuführen. Der Angriff konzentriert sich auf die Funktion 'iconv' des GB18030-Decoders und nutzt eine Ineffizienz bei der Datenverarbeitung aus. Es wird vermutet, dass die Manipulation von Eingabedaten für die Funktion 'iconv' die ineffiziente algorithmische Komplexität auslösen kann. Die lokale Natur des Angriffs begrenzt seinen Umfang, kann aber in Umgebungen, in denen lokaler Zugriff relativ einfach zu erhalten ist, dennoch erheblich sein. Das Fehlen detaillierter Informationen über die spezifische Manipulation erschwert die genaue Risikobewertung.
Systems running musl libc versions 1.2.0 through 1.2.6 are at risk, particularly those where local access is readily available. Embedded systems and containers utilizing musl libc are also potential targets.
• linux / server:
journalctl -g "iconv" -p err• linux / server:
ps aux | grep iconvdisclosure
Exploit-Status
EPSS
0.01% (3% Perzentil)
CVSS-Vektor
Die primäre Abmilderung für CVE-2026-6042 ist die Anwendung eines Patches. Da es keine offizielle Lösung gibt, sollten Benutzer nach Patches aus seriösen Quellen suchen, wie z. B. dem offiziellen musl libc-Repository oder über ihre Betriebssystemdistributoren. Es ist entscheidend, die Authentizität des Patches zu überprüfen, bevor Sie ihn installieren. In der Zwischenzeit kann die Überwachung der Systemressourcennutzung, insbesondere CPU und Speicher, helfen, potenzielle Angriffe zu erkennen. Die Beschränkung des lokalen Zugriffs auf das System kann ebenfalls dazu beitragen, das Risiko zu verringern. Ein Upgrade auf eine gepatchte Version von musl libc ist die effektivste und am meisten empfohlene Lösung.
Aplique el parche proporcionado por el proveedor para mitigar la complejidad algorítmica ineficiente en el decodificador GB18030 de musl libc. Consulte las fuentes de referencia para obtener más detalles sobre el parche y su aplicación.
Schwachstellenanalysen und kritische Warnungen direkt in deinen Posteingang.
musl libc ist eine minimalistische und leistungsstarke C-Bibliothek, die in eingebetteten Systemen und anderen Umgebungen verwendet wird, in denen Größe und Effizienz entscheidend sind.
Dies bedeutet, dass der GB18030-Dekodierungsprozess mehr Ressourcen (CPU, Speicher) verbraucht als für eine gültige Eingabe erwartet, was zu einer Verlangsamung oder einem Absturz des Systems führen kann.
Überprüfen Sie die installierte Version von musl libc in Ihrem System. Wenn sie kleiner als 1.2.6 ist, ist sie anfällig. Konsultieren Sie die Dokumentation Ihrer Linux-Distribution, um Anweisungen zum Überprüfen der Version zu erhalten.
Sie sollten nach dem Patch im offiziellen musl libc-Repository oder über Ihren Betriebssystemdistributor suchen. Stellen Sie sicher, dass Sie die Authentizität des Patches überprüfen, bevor Sie ihn installieren.
Überwachen Sie die Systemressourcennutzung und beschränken Sie den lokalen Zugriff auf das System, um das Risiko zu mindern.
Lade deine Abhängigkeitsdatei hoch und erfahre sofort, ob dich diese und andere CVEs treffen.